Fly to Buenos Aires, Argentina, then take a domestic flight to Jujuy (approx. 2 hours). From Jujuy, Purmamarca is about 65km away, reachable by bus or taxi (approx. 1 hour). No direct international flights to Jujuy.
The most convenient airport for both domestic and international travellers is Gobernador Horacio Guzmán International Airport in Jujuy, Argentina. It's approximately 96 kilometres from Purmamarca, offering the shortest and most direct route.
Purmamarca, Argentina, lacks public transport. However, the village is small enough to explore on foot. For longer distances, hiring a bicycle or car is recommended. Car hire services are available in nearby Jujuy. Always remember to drive on the right side of the road in Argentina.
The best area to stay in Purmamarca, Argentina, is the town centre. It's popular due to its proximity to the main square, local markets, and the iconic Cerro de los Siete Colores. It offers a variety of accommodation options suitable for all budgets.

The trip between Purmamarca and Salinas Grandes is breathtaking. 4500 meters altitude along the Andes, views changing every minute. I would recommend taking enough time for this trip both ways, since it is almost necesary to stop every minute for sightseeing. The trip is a destination in itself!!!
